This news is official. World of Warcraft Patch 3.3 will be out later this day across North American Servers. Patch 3.3: Fall of the Lich King is the last big content patch for the second expansion of World of Warcraft: Wrath of the Lich King before WOW’s third expansion Cataclysm. FYI, World of Warcraft: Cataclysm is scheduled to be launced by 2nd half of 2010 alongside Starcraft II that is if Blizzard would be true to its word.
According to Kotaku, Patch 3.3 has a total size of 750MB that will add three new 5-man dungeons and one new 10/25-man raid to Icecrown Citadel, a new built-in quest tracker and a new Looking for Group system, among other things. The patch will hit European servers later tonight.
